Professor John Ward's scholarly papers are available at the Northwestern University Archives.

As a pioneer in the academic study of family enterprises at the Kellogg Center for Family Enterprises, Professor Ward's papers represent a comprehensive body of work that provides rich and authoritative insights into this uniquely complex segment of the global economy. We are enormously grateful to Professor Ward for this valuable contribution to the field.

These one-of-a-kind papers will offer unprecedented access into Professor Ward's scholarly process. The collection is contained in 37 boxes, with material spanning the years 1976-2017. The records include:

  • Biographical and Early Professional Materials
  • Books
  • Articles and Journals
  • Speeches and Presentations
  • Case Studies
  • Digital Materials
  • Audiovisual Materials
The archive contains materials in English, Spanish, Portuguese, Italian, French, German, Chinese, Japanese, Serbian, Arabic, Hebrew, Dutch, and Thai and includes Professor Ward's work at Loyola University.

The John Ward papers are non-circulating and are open to the public for research and reference.
